Determine whether each statement is true or false. If the statement is false, make the necessary change(s) to produce a true statement.The graph of a function with origin symmetry can rise to the left and rise to the right.
Step 1
A function has origin symmetry if it is unchanged when rotated by 180° about the origin. In other words, for every point (x, y) on the graph, the point (-x, -y) is also on the graph. Show more…
